Reproduktion Les filles de Daniel T. MacFarlan - Theodore E. Pine – Einführung fesselnd In der faszinierenden Welt der Kunst heben sich bestimmte Werke durch ihre Fähigkeit hervor, flüchtige Momente und intensive Emotionen einzufangen. "Les filles de Daniel T. MacFarlan" von Theodore E. Pine ist ein perfektes Beispiel dafür. Dieses Werk, geprägt von Zartheit und Lebendigkeit, entführt uns in eine Welt, in der Gesichter und Gesten Geschichten erzählen. Beim Betrachten dieses Kunstdrucks werden wir in das Herz einer intimen Szene versetzt, in der jedes Detail sorgfältig gestaltet ist, um Zärtlichkeit und Verbundenheit zu vermitteln. Der Künstler schafft es, einen stillen Dialog zwischen den Figuren zu erzeugen, der den Betrachter einlädt, über ihre Beziehung und ihr Universum nachzudenken. Das Licht, die Farben und die Ausdrücke machen dieses Werk zu einem wahren Meisterstück, das das unbestreitbare Talent von Pine beweist. Stil und Einzigartigkeit des Werks Der Stil von Theodore E. Pine zeichnet sich durch einen realistischen Ansatz aus, bei dem die genaue Beobachtung der menschlichen Natur im Vordergrund steht. In "Les filles de Daniel T. MacFarlan" nutzt der Künstler Maltechniken, die die Sanftheit der Züge und die Reichtum der Emotionen hervorheben. Die Gesichter der Mädchen, voller Frische und Lebendigkeit, werden mit einer Präzision dargestellt, die an Hyperrealismus grenzt, dabei aber eine poetische Note bewahrt. Die Farbpalette, die Pine wählt, spielt eine entscheidende Rolle in der Komposition und schwankt zwischen subtilen Pastelltönen und lebhafteren Nuancen, die das Auge anziehen. Diese geschickte Mischung schafft eine Atmosphäre, die sowohl ruhig als auch dynamisch ist, in der jede Figur unter dem bewundernden Blick des Betrachters zum Leben erweckt wird. Die sorgfältig orchestrierte Komposition lenkt den Blick und lädt zu einer vertieften Erkundung jedes Elements und Details ein. Der Künstler und sein Einfluss Theodore E. Pine, eine bedeutende Figur der Malerei des 19. Jahrhunderts, hat seine Epoche durch seinen einzigartigen Ansatz und seine künstlerische Sensibilität geprägt. Beeinflusst von den großen Meistern der Vergangenheit, entwickelte er einen eigenen Stil, der Tradition und Innovation vereint. Sein Werk, reich an Emotionen und Nuancen, zeugt von einem tiefen Verständnis der menschlichen Natur. Durch die Beschäftigung mit zwischenmenschlichen Beziehungen konnte Pine Momente des Lebens einfangen, die noch immer nachhallen.
